Transaction 253dd38c4e4bebd644615106d1b28e1328b29bb4a677e1a260a35044f4928f25

18 Input
2 Outputs
  • 253dd38c4e4bebd644615106d1b28e1328b29bb4a677e1a260a35044f4928f25:0
  • value  120000000
    address  3Am5SryaFfJGXVSVJZg86CTXhBmfg8i5Tp
  • 253dd38c4e4bebd644615106d1b28e1328b29bb4a677e1a260a35044f4928f25:1
  • value  357349
    address  3D63ZHv8KvswUMqxEpLGQ1E2YiriCvyEZ4